Belding, located in Ionia County, Michigan, is a charming small town known for its rich textile history and family-friendly atmosphere. Situated along the scenic Flat River, Belding offers a close-knit community with a range of outdoor recreational opportunities. Downtown Belding

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Downtown Belding is the central hub of the town, offering a vibrant mix of historic charm and modern conveniences. Residents enjoy proximity to local shops, cafes, and community events, making it a great place for social interactions.
Characteristics of the Downtown Belding
* Culture: Rich local history with art galleries and theatres
* Transportation: Very walkable; Public transit available for longer distances
* Services: Grocery stores, restaurants, parks, and community centers
* Environment: Friendly and community-oriented
Housing Options in the Downtown Belding
Single-family homes, Apartments, Townhouses
Average Home Prices in the Downtown Belding
* Buying: $150,000 – $220,000
* Renting: $900 – $1,300/month
Riverside Area

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
The Riverside Area features beautiful properties along the Flat River, perfect for those who appreciate nature and outdoor activities. Residents enjoy walking trails, fishing, and scenic views right from their backyards.
Characteristics of the Riverside Area
* Culture: Outdoor-focused living with recreational opportunities
* Transportation: Biking-friendly paths, car necessary for longer trips
* Services: Limited amenities nearby, but close to nature parks
* Environment: Peaceful and serene, suitable for nature lovers
Housing Options in the Riverside Area
Single-family homes, Riverfront cottages
Average Home Prices in the Riverside Area
* Buying: $180,000 – $250,000
* Renting: $1,000 – $1,400/month
Maple Grove

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Located just outside the city center, Maple Grove is a family-friendly neighborhood with tree-lined streets and spacious yards. It's ideal for those seeking a suburban lifestyle with easy access to schools and parks.
Characteristics of the Maple Grove
* Culture: Community-centric with strong family values
* Transportation: Biking and walking paths; nearby access to main roads
* Services: Schools, playgrounds, and local shops within reach
* Environment: Safe and welcoming for families
Housing Options in the Maple Grove
Single-family homes, New constructions
Average Home Prices in the Maple Grove
* Buying: $160,000 – $230,000
* Renting: $950 – $1,250/month
North Belding

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
North Belding is known for its larger plots and rural feel while still being conveniently close to town amenities. This area is ideal for those who enjoy gardening and having a bit of distance from neighbors.
Characteristics of the North Belding
* Culture: Rural lifestyle close to urban conveniences
* Transportation: Car essential for commuting
* Services: Nearby grocery stores and essential services in town
* Environment: Quiet and spacious with friendly neighbors
Housing Options in the North Belding
Single-family homes on larger lots
Average Home Prices in the North Belding
* Buying: $170,000 – $240,000
* Renting: $800 – $1,200/month
West Main Street Area

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
This area features a mix of charming older homes and modern upgrades. Its location along West Main Street provides easy access to retail, dining, and community services.
Characteristics of the West Main Street Area
* Culture: A mix of historic and contemporary vibes
* Transportation: Easy access to public transportation and major roads
* Services: Variety of restaurants and shopping options, parks
* Environment: Dynamic and varied, appealing to diverse residents
Housing Options in the West Main Street Area
Victorian homes, Modernized single-family homes
Average Home Prices in the West Main Street Area
* Buying: $140,000 – $210,000
* Renting: $850 – $1,150/month
Belding Estates

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Belding Estates is a newer development that offers contemporary homes in a planned community setup. This area is especially appealing to young professionals and families looking for modern amenities.
Characteristics of the Belding Estates
* Culture: Emerging community with modern conveniences
* Transportation: Designed for car commuting; public transport options available
* Services: Phase II construction nearing completion; new shops coming soon
* Environment: Community-oriented with events and activities
Housing Options in the Belding Estates
New single-family homes, Semi-detached homes
Average Home Prices in the Belding Estates
* Buying: $200,000 – $300,000
* Renting: $1,100 – $1,500/month
